(USA Rugby Press Release)—USA Women’s Eagles Head Coach, Sione Fukofuka announced today his plans to step away from his role with USA Rugby.

Fukofuka was appointed Head Coach in November of 2023, before leading the Women’s fifteens to Rugby World Cup 2025 qualification and broadly supporting a re-energized High Performance Pathway.

Navy put up an impressive score on Queens Saturday, beating their former Rugby East rivals 50-14.

However, it’s worth noting that it was 12-7 at halftime.

Navy over the last couple of years has gained a reputation for being a second-half team, and this matchup didn’t dispel the image.

In a thrilling in-state rivalry clash, the University of Iowa edged out Iowa State 24–22 in a back-and-forth contest marked by tough defense, heavy collisions, gusty winds, and multiple lead changes in the final minutes.

This was a Heart of America Conference game and with Iowa State being the defending champs, it was expected to be tough sledding for the Hawkeyes.

The USA men put together an improved performance in their second pool game in the Pacific Nations Cup, and while Japan won the game, there were some steps forward for the Eagles.

Japan was expected to be fast and to offload well and to be difficult in the kicking game. Most of that came to pass, although the USA kicking game seemed much improved Saturday in Sacramento.
